Video Journalist, Gray TV/ WAVE3, Louisville KY

WAVE 3 News in Louisville, KY is looking for a Video Journalist to be a part of our market-leading team. The person we hire will edit newscasts, shoot news and sporting events, as well as work with MMJs and anchors. The ideal candidate will fit in with the WAVE 3 News culture of teamwork and collaboration

RESPONSIBILITIES will include (but not be limited to) the following:

  • Shoot and edit video and audio for broadcast using non-linear software.
  • Respond immediately to breaking or urgent news events.
  • Tell visually-creative stories.
  • Work in a collaborative environment with reporters, producers, assignment editors, and managers.
  • Communicate with reporters, writers, and producers.
  • Be open to critiques, feedback and training.
  • Work evenings, weekends and holidays as needed.
  • Perform other duties as assigned.

QUALIFICATIONS/REQUIREMENTS:

  • 1-3 years’ experience as a news photographer/editor.
  • Must be able to edit on non-linear equipment and to adapt to new technology.
  • Must possess strong initiative and attention to detail.
  • Ability to remain positive and foster a positive work environment.
  • Must be able to work well under pressure with limited supervision and daily deadlines.
  • Bachelor’s Degree in Journalism, Communication or related field preferred.
  • Driver’s License Required

            WAVE 3 News is the NBC affiliate for Louisville, KY. We are Kentucky’s first television station, and we lead the way in connecting the people of WAVE Country. We offer nearly 50 hours of local television news per week, 40 hours of live programming in the field throughout the week of the Kentucky Derby, and much more coverage on our web, mobile, OTT and social channels throughout the year.
